Initiated in 1988, the school liaison is a partnership program between the Brunswick School System and the Division of Police.
The officers assigned to the program work with school staff, parents and students to resolve a wide range of problems which occur in the school, the home and the community. The police officers provide intervention services which include investigation and filing charges and/or complaints including for truancy violations (may result in a state suspension of a driver's license) and educational services.
